Output 21a74326660af8897bfaf8597ce7c8111bf364a19c731bc3483b9b384f60a285:7

value
716734870
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bfa9986e05468a6b1bfe2a6896f3770d617b59f OP_EQUALVERIFY OP_CHECKSIG
address
1J8wZr3uLVvJESoFSt7JPCAxScu2pqTQhb
transaction
21a74326660af8897bfaf8597ce7c8111bf364a19c731bc3483b9b384f60a285
spent
true